Windows 8 Demo at CES 2012

Tami Reller, Chief Marketing Officer of Windows, gives a preview of Windows 8 during the Microsoft keynote at CES 2012.

What are your first impressions of Windows 8?

Microsoft’s App Store will open in late February 2013. How will the store fare in relation to Apple’s and Google’s stores?